There is little additional information about the Utrecht-based formation and the planned release of their previous singles. So in the case of DANGEROUS TIMES FOR THE DEAD, let's just let their muck speak, which is usually the best.

The six tracks of the download don't really sound Dutch or even continental European. If I had to guess, I would have rather tapped into a band from the days of the New Wave of British Heavy Metal, from which one would have made a compilation. For the fact that the boys still seem relatively young and the band was founded only in 2018, DANGEROUS TIMES FOR THE DEAD sound wonderfully anachronistic after the eighties.

This is not new, but it does really well with tracks like the Mid Tempo rocker 'Fairytale', the Groover 'Crystal Gazer' and my personal favorite track of the Dutch, the hymn-like vocals 'Storm The Castle'. Underground truffle pigs are recommended for a closer inspection. I'm curious to see what we will hear from the chapel in the future.

Ludwig Lücker awards 7 out of 10 points - Obliveon

DANGEROUS TIMES FOR THE DEAD is a Dutch Heavy Metal band that sounds they have been transported straight out of the 80's; a hard & heavy, classic but fresh sound, truly makes them a part of the New Wave of Traditional Heavy Metal. Full of energy, entertaining and powerful, epic guitar solos, thumping bass and drums and a singer who cuts through all this violence with true heavy metal, high-pitched vocals. What makes them stand apart is their unique, fresh and modern-day approach, both in sound and online presence. Their goal is to passionately blast out traditional heavy metal, giving you music to raise your fists and bang your heads too!

On Monday the 14th of December Dangerous Times for the Dead will release their latest single "Storm the Castle", where they bang out another classic sounding metal track, about knights preparing for battle, a call to power, a metal rebel yell with howling metal screams!
